ABSTRACT:
A computer system is described in which a table created in memory includes drive description data for one or more IDE devices included in the system. A command intercept circuit is described which intercepts device-identification commands and reroutes the device-identification operation to memory. The command intercept circuit includes an address decode circuit which asserts a first control signal upon decoding an address corresponding with the one or more IDE devices. A command decode circuit responds to the asserted first control signal to decode data and asserts a second control signal when the decoded data corresponds with a device-identification command. An address generator responds to the asserted second control signal to generate a memory address where the drive description data table is stored.
